6m'The saga continues': Lyme property to undergo cleanout against owner's wishes
LYME — A years-long conflict between the town and a resident over an old family farm that a judge ruled is an illegal junkyard is headed for one last deadline. 5mVermont regulators finalize 5.5% rate increase for Green Mountain Power customers
Vermont regulators approved a 5.5% electricity rate hike for Green Mountain Power's 275,000 customers, effective October 1, after rejecting a larger initial request and scaling back proposed resilience spending.
